PHP FastCGI SAPI: перезагрузка конфигурации PHP

Уже существует уровень RAID для того, что Вы хотите; это назвало RAID 10.

СВБР для дисков профессионального и потребительского уровня увеличилось порядком величины в последние годы, некорректируемый коэффициент ошибок остался относительно постоянным. Этот уровень оценивается в 10^14 биты, так один бит на чтение на 12 терабайт, для потребителя диски SATA, источник.

Так, для каждого сканирования Ваших передач Вашего диска на 24 ТБ статистически Вы встретитесь по крайней мере с 2 единственными битовыми ошибками. Каждая из тех ошибок инициирует RAID5, восстанавливают, и хуже, во время восстанавливают вторую ошибку, вызовет двойной отказ.

1
задан 10 December 2009 в 11:50
3 ответа

Насколько я знаю, интерпретатор FastCGI PHP не реагирует на сигналы как HUP, USR1 или USR2 перезагружать его конфигурацию.

Возможно, PHP-FPM мог помочь Вам достигнуть того, что Вы хотите. На оборотной стороне это требует исправлению PHP.

1
ответ дан 3 December 2019 в 19:53

Если серверы порождены автоматически, уничтожают их. Если они вручную запускаются, перезапускают их. PHP не имеет способности перезагрузить ее собственную конфигурацию — и обычно, уничтожение/перезапуск не является проблемой. Существует ли причина, почему Вы не можете уничтожить их в этом экземпляре?

1
ответ дан 3 December 2019 в 19:53

Если вы используете PHP5, попробуйте это

sudo /etc/init.d/php5-fpm reload

В противном случае

sudo /etc/init.d/php-fpm reload

Эта команда корректно перезапустит сервер без закрытия существующих соединений.

1
ответ дан 3 December 2019 в 19:53

Теги

Похожие вопросы